Output 23026571b02f56be450dd11293a3fc33a6b5cc05e34f824398f5266f3e00a37a:3

value
58318
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d84801b745ae60f9705966a8c899aaf6980a81e20719ffdfcdbf74933330607b
address
bc1pmpyqrd694es0juzev65v3xd276vq4q0zquvllh7dha6fxvesvpaswucfhn
transaction
23026571b02f56be450dd11293a3fc33a6b5cc05e34f824398f5266f3e00a37a
spent
true